[Asia Economy (Daejeon) Reporter Jeong Il-woong] Daejeon City is launching the development and demonstration of the ‘Daejeon-type hydrogen fuel cell’ in collaboration with the local fuel cell manufacturer HN Power Co., Ltd.
On the 29th, according to the city, the city and HN Power were recently selected for the Ministry of SMEs and Startups’ core technology development project for hydrogen fuel cells, enabling HN Power to demonstrate the fuel cells it independently developed.
Previously, the city participated in the Ministry’s contest with a plan to demonstrate the developed product at Hanbat Arboretum for two years to achieve the hydrogen fuel cell technology development goals.
This project aims to invest 240 million KRW in national funds and 60 million KRW from the fuel cell developer to promote development and demonstration over 24 months from December this year to November 2022, with the goal of obtaining official certification (KGS, KS) for solid oxide fuel cells (SOFC) with an efficiency of over 90%.
Hydrogen fuel cells are a new energy source that produces electricity through electrochemical reactions without combustion, emitting almost no pollutants, and their safety has already been verified in advanced countries, posing no risk.
